Synthesis of fluorene‐based high performance polymers. I. Poly(arylene thioether)s with excellent solubility and high refractive index

Abstract:Several poly(arylene thioether)s ( PTEs ) containing a fluorene moiety were synthesized by the polycondensation of masked dithiols such as 9,9‐bis(4‐(N,N‐dimethyl‐S‐carbamoyl)phenyl)fluorene and various difluoroarenes. All PTEs were obtained in quantitative yields. The PTEs showed good thermal stability: the 10% weight loss temperature was over 480 °C under both nitrogen and air atmosphere by TGA, and glass temperature was within a range of 204–275 °C by DSC. Most PTEs exhibited remarkably high refractive index values in a range of 1.66–1.72 at 589 nm, whereas they had a very low degree of birefringence properties. Furthermore, the PTEs showed high solubility in ordinary organic solvents such as chloroform, N‐methylpyrrolidone, and tetrahydrofuran. © 2007 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.
